Drexel is a CDP located in the county of Montgomery in the U.S. state of Ohio.
Quick Facts about Drexel
| Population : | 2,076 |
| Country : | United States of America |
| State : | Ohio (United States) |
| County : | Montgomery County |
| Postal code : | 45417 |
| Area : | 5.66 km2 |
| Altitude : | 951 feet / 290 meters |
| Time Zone : | America/New_York |
